  1. Jul 13, 2024 · Rim Lighting: Use backlighting to create a rim of light around your subject’s edges to separate them from the background and add a halo effect. Catchlights: Ensure catchlights in your subject’s eyes by using reflective surfaces or light sources to add sparkle and life to portrait photography.

Jul 14, 2024 · Photography typically utilizes strobes or flashes for brief, intense bursts of light, whereas videography necessitates continuous lighting to maintain a steady and consistent illumination throughout filming. Certain tools, such as LEDs or softboxes, can be utilized interchangeably for both photography and videography.

  6. Jul 15, 2024 · Older cameras often struggle with low-light, sometimes struggling with focus, with massively lower dynamic range to boot, giving some photos the look of film photography. In fact, many early digital cameras, sometimes referred to as “Y2K digicam“, are downright terrible compared to modern cameras and smartphones.
